4-3. Do-it-yourself maintenance
Do-it-yourself service precautions
If you perform maintenance by yourself, be sure to follow the correct
procedure as given in these sections.
12-volt battery condition
Brake fluid level
Engine/power control unit coolant
level

Parts and tools
• Grease
• Conventional wrench
(for terminal clamp bolts)
• FMVSS No.116 DOT 3 or SAE
J1703 brake fluid
• Rag or paper towel
• Funnel (used only for adding
brake fluid)
• "Toyota Super Long Life Coolant"
or a similar high quality ethylene
glycol-based non-silicate, non-
amine, non-nitrite and non-borate
coolant with long-life hybrid
organic acid technology
For the U.S.A.:
"Toyota Super Long Life Cool-
ant" is pre-mixed with 50% cool-
ant and 50% deionized water.
For Canada:
"Toyota Super Long Life Cool-
ant" is pre-mixed with 55% cool-
ant and 45% deionized water.
• Funnel (used only for adding cool-
ant)
